Ergebnis 1 bis 9 von 9

Baum-Darstellung

  1. #9
    VIP
    Registriert seit
    05.11.2012
    Beiträge
    587
    Thanks
    83
    Thanked 101 Times in 80 Posts
    Ich löse das per Script (was Bestandteil vom Backup ist), dabei wird bei jedem Neustart der Box überprüft ob die Plugins noch aktuell sind bzw. werden sie nach einem Image update neuinstalliert. Spart Zeit und ich muss nicht immer den Rechner anschmeissen.

    Code:
    opkg update
    opkg update
    i=0
    cat "/hdd/boxware/pluginlist" | while read line; do
    echo plugin ueberpruefen
    i=$(( $i + 1 ))
        if [ ! "$line" = "$(opkg list-installed | grep "$line")" ] || [ ! "$line" = "$(opkg list | grep "$line" | cut -d" " -f1-3)" ]; then
            opkg install "$(echo "$line" | cut -d" " -f1)" || find "/hdd/boxware" -name "$(echo "$line" |cut -d" " -f1)*" -exec opkg install {} \;
            echo $line
            if [ $i = $(cat "/hdd/boxware/pluginlist" | wc -l) ]; then
                shutdown -r now
            else
                wget -O /dev/null "http://sz/web/message?text=Plugins%20update,%20Bitte%20neustarten!&type=2"
            fi
        fi
    done
    Die Datei pluginlist kann man zum Beispiel so anlegen
    Code:
    opkg list-installed | egrep -v "hdmu|rcs" >/hdd/wohin_ich_will/pluginlist

    MfG
    Geändert von /dev/null (04.12.2014 um 16:05 Uhr)

  2. The Following 3 Users Say Thank You to /dev/null For This Useful Post:



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•